## Dark Mode in the Hollowpine Admin Dashboard

If your plugin renders inside Hollowpine, don't hardcode colors — the dashboard swaps themes via CSS variables, and dark mode will happily make your white-on-white text invisible. Use the provided tokens (`--hp-surface`, `--hp-text`, etc.) and test both themes before shipping. The full token list and theming do's and don'ts live here.

dashboard of kawip-kajep = https://jira.qorvellabs.internal/display/browse/projects/projects/a194

## v4.2.1 — Spreadsheet export, now less hungry

Hey newcomers! Quick one: the Gridlet export pipeline used to load entire workbooks into memory, which meant big sheets on Tablewise Cloud could balloon past 2 GB and get OOM-killed. We switched to streaming rows in chunks of 5,000, so peak memory now stays under 180 MB even on monster files. If you see weird truncation in exports, this change is the first place to look. Questions about the streaming writer should go to the engineer who owns it.

named custodian: Casvan Rusox

☐ Lost your badge already? Happens to the best of us at Quillmont. Head to the front desk, tell whoever's on shift, and they'll kill the old badge and order a replacement — usually ready by lunch. Don't borrow a teammate's badge, tempting as it is. Until the new one arrives, you can get through the main doors with the code below.

staff pass of baduf-tawig = bdg-JZQJMP-06442516